In your opinion when is the best time to experience ST? I have been once during the middle of March and am thinking of trying to make it down next year.

Posted

I'm more interested in the drills and the minor-league-field games than in the nominal big-league games there. So for me, earlier is better. If your priority is the opposite of mine then maybe later is better so that you are watching a more settled game lineup.

Posted

In my opinion the best time is a week before they have to report til a week after, that is if you have 2 weeks. If only a week a few days before they have to report to start.

The main prerogative would be to get autographs, watch drills - see minor league and major league players participate. Games aren't necessarily the main objective. I've done that and it was fun, but I want a more "personal" experience. I am a teacher and would have the 2nd or 3rd week in February off.

 

If that is the goal, I would say the 3rd week of February. Minor leaguers who are neither on the 40-man nor invited to the big league camp report usually a week after the major leaguers. Lots of them will be around earlier, but the closer to reporting days the best chances you have to see them all...
